Red Velvet Cake. Mmm... my mouth is already watering! Throughout the 1920s, red velvet was the signature dessert at NYC's Waldorf-Astoria Hotel. Since then, it’s become a favorite confection that never fails to impress. And who could forget the armadillo-shaped red velvet groom’s cake in the Julia Roberts flick Steel Magnolias?

Nicole and Joe’s vision of their wedding included the peacock, its feather and the feather’s jewel tones. Since she was using the feather throughout the decor of her event, she wanted the actual feather somehow incorporated into the invitation suite as well. She wanted the invitations to have an antique feel to them.
